Hit Man (2024): New Linklater. I didn't know much about it going in, but it turned out to be a strange romantic comedy. Some funny parts but nothing special, and I found the direction it went toward the end unsatisfying.
Speak No Evil (2024): Blumhouse horror in the Hostel genre. The build-up is well-paced and there's some really good acting. It was, however, very predictable, and although often tense, it doesn't quite reach scary. Worth a watch.
French Girl (2024): Romantic comedy set in Québec City. Full of simple but effective humour and self-deprecating Québécois steteotypes, à la Bon Cop Bad Cop. Fun to see so many local stars acting alongside big American names.
